Fits on mine, only difference is the firing pins.

A shotgun firing pin is rounder and the rifle firing pin is sharper, they say the 219 firing pin will pierce a shotgun primer but I've switched barrels before and never had that happen with any of them, I think it's just a Bu** sh** story.

Originally Posted by 1899sav
Question
Will the 28 ga
Fit on a 219 Savage?
Steve


ALL 220, 220L, 220AC, 220PC, 219, 219B, & 219L barrels will fit Model 219 and early Model 220 receivers.

Conversely, Model 219 & early Model 220 barrels are no good at all on any of the later guns for more than the 1st/only shot.

The reason, FWIW, is that the first generation model 219 rifles & 220 shotguns were striker-fired guns, recocked by the action of a top opening lever.

The later top-lever models 219B, 220PC, 220AC, and the side opening lever models 219L & 220L were all fired by an internal hammer which was recocked during the barrel swing-open by a cocking stud on the side of the bbl lug engaging a cocking hook lying inside the RH receiver sidewall.

The early bbls don't have the cocking stud needed to recock the later actions; and the early actions can be recocked regardless if the bbl has a cocking stud/not, by operating the top lever.
